Background and Objectives: To achieve significant throughput, Interference alignment (IA) is an encouraging technique for wireless Interference networks. In this study, we design an aligned beamformer based on the Interference leakage minimization (ILM) method to reduce the Interference power for a multiple-input multiple-output Interference channel (MIMO-IC). Methods: To deal with the non-convexity of ILM problem, we used a non-convex programming method (i. e., difference of convex [DC]). In this way, the Interference leakage function is reformulated to a DC function including difference of two convex terms. Then, an additive function is defined that includes the DC objective function and a penalty function. Results: We propose a novel DC-based IA algorithm that uses solutions of an upper bound of the additive function in each iteration; as the initial state for the next iteration. Through an iterative manner and for the large values of the penalty factor, the solutions of upper bound function converge to the solutions of the original DC objective function (i. e., Interference leakage function). Conclusion: In contrast to the frequent IA methods, the proposed DC-based IA algorithm updates transmit-and receive-beamformers in each iteration jointly (not alternately). Simulation results indicate that the proposed method outperforms some competitive IA algorithms by providing more throughputs and less Interference leakage.

In this paper, we evaluate various system configurations for crosstalk cancellation using Interference alignment (IA) in uncoordinated and partially coordinated downstream G. fast. In the first configuration, which can be implemented in a distributed fashion, signal-level coordination between users is unnecessary and IA is applied in the frequency domain. In the second configuration, partial signal-level coordination is available; however, it is entirely consumed by vectoring and IA is applied in the frequency domain. In the third configuration, partial signal-level coordination is available, but vectoring is not applied. Instead, IA is applied jointly in both the space and frequency domains. Considerably higher sum bit rates are achieved using the third configuration; however, the computational complexity is noticeably higher than the other two configurations. To tackle this problem, we propose a joint partial vectoring design based on the third configuration which outperforms the diagonalizing pre-compensator (a.k.a. zero-forcing precoder) considerably. Then we employ it in the second configuration to obtain a high-performance crosstalk cancellation scheme with much lower complexity. Our simulation results show that depending on the level of coordination, IA increases the achievable rates of G. fast loops significantly compared to available solutions with comparable complexity.

Growing demand to access frequency spectrum, cognitive radio is introduced so that the secondary users (SU) are allowed to use unused spectrum of primary user. If the primary user (PU) uses the full frequency spectrum, the existing unused spectrum in space-domain can create ideal opportunistic Interference alignment considering cognitive networks. Since the PU knows perfect channel knowledge, it can perform water-filling algorithm and singular value decomposition, then secondary users transmit along the spatial direction with the design pre-coder. In this paper, we improve the efficiency of the system with a transmit space-time coding technique introduced by Alamouti. In this regard, the SU transmit and receive antennas are reduced and after performing Interference alignment algorithm, but the Interference does not becomes exactly zero. In fact, to remove this Interference, SU transmits Alamouti code. In this paper, we consider the case of two secondary users opportunistically exploiting the same frequency band utilized by a licensed user. Our goal is to design low-complexity precoders to realize Interference cancellation for each secondary user. The main idea is to design precoders such that the two users transmit over two orthogonal spaces. As a result, the decoders can project the received signals to each of the orthogonal spaces and decode the information of each user without any Interference from the other user.

One of the common challenges in wireless communications networks is wiretapping broadcast signals from radio stations by eavesdroppers. In this paper is shown that Interference alignment (IA) technique can be completely eliminated intra and inter-cell Interferences, in a cellular communications network with the same frequency allocation to all of the users. Also, this technique is able to provide maximum degrees of freedom (DoF) and securing the communication against eavesdropping. IA approximately can close the rate of network secrecy to rate region of the interfering broadcast channel (IFBC) in high SNR regime. In order to prove the mathematical and intuitive capability of the Interference alignment technique in increasing communication security, a kind of IA algorithm closed-form is used in the downlink of an unsecured cellular network. Simulation results are demonstrated for a certain range from the number of eavesdropper’s receive antennas, that secrecy rate well possible come close to the network sum-capacity in high SNRs.

Interference alignment (IA) with Alamouti coding is an innovative method to increase the multiplexing gain and the diversity gain, simultaneously, in wireless Multiple-Input Multiple-Output (MIMO) systems. The main limitation of this method is requiring Perfect Channel State Information (CSI) to perform the beamforming on transmitters and receivers signals. Contrary to the acceptable performance of Alamouti coding in perfect CSI conditions, its efficiency is severely reduced in imperfect CSI conditions. In order to overcome this shortcoming, this paper discusses about the effect of imperfect CSI on a two user MIMO X-channel which uses Interference alignment together with Alamouti coding. Also, a closed form solution is extracted for the received signal in an imperfect CSI scenario. Our analysis shows that when the variance of the CSI error is increased, the Bit Error Rate (BER) of system increases linearly. Also, we propose a joint Power Allocation (PA) and constellation rotation algorithm to improve the performance of system in an imperfect CSI scenario. Computer simulations show a desirable improvement in BER by using PA, constellation rotation and joint of them.

Introduction: In the current research, it has been tried to qualitatively study all kinds of policies and measures necessary for alignment between teacher preparation programs and democratic social education competencies under the model of teacher education curricula, which include: direct (official) curriculum, Indirect curriculum, informal curriculum (implicit) and unstructured curriculum (hidden) should be identified in the educational system. Method: Qualitative approach and phenomenological method were used in this research. The field of research is Farhangian University of Hormozgan and the participants are  13  lecturers of this university. The sampling method is a combination of convenience and snowball sampling. The research tool was a semi-structured interview. The information was analyzed using thematic analysis method and then using MAXQDA software... Result: The information was analyzed using the theme analysis method and then using MAXQDA software in the form of 2  overarching themes, 8 organizing themes and 25  basic themes. The results of this research showed the basic policies and measures for teacher preparation programs, in the form of two components, strategies and solutions of teacher training curricula, separated by curricula (formal, informal, informal, unstructured curriculum) and with the goal of preparing The formation of teachers has been identified in the educational system to realize the competencies of democratic social education. Conclusion: Therefore, examining the opportunities, facilities, and resources available to achieve these actions should be on the agenda of decision makers and educational planners. It is necessary to pay special attention to the strategies and solutions of teacher training curricula.

One of the most important organizational challenges is the strategic alignment between information technology (IT) and business objectives. Organizations have deployed different approaches to achieve strategic alignment and competitive advantage. Enterprise architecture (EA) has been viewed as an effective approach not only for optimum management of IT, but also for strategic alignment of IT applications and business needs. EA maturity indicates the degree of attaining EA project goals, out of which, is the IT-Business alignment. In this paper, the relationship between enterprise architecture maturity (EAM) and strategic alignment maturity model (SAMM) has been investigated to declare whether EAM can act as enabler for SAMM. Research population includes enterprises in which, the EA project is implemented. Pearson’s correlation and regression test have been used for analyzing the data gathered by questionnaire. The findings indicate that the success of EA significantly influences strategic alignment maturity.

In this paper, a step-by-step laboratory procedure for performing a satellite's payload’s alignment measurement is presented. Four highly accurate theodolites are used along with two or more alignment corner cube to accurately extract the final attitude. Theodolites are arranged around the satellite in such a way that they have a clear direct view of the alignment cubes mounted on the payload and the satellite. Two theodolites should point to the payload’s alignment cube and the other two theodolites must point to the satellite’s alignment cube. Each theodolite must see at least one other theodolite, directly. Finally, by forming the coordinates systems of the payload and satellite in the theodolites coordinate system along with using the coordinate transfer matrices, the payload alignment correction matrix will be extracted in detail. The total method accuracy is within the order of few arcseconds.
